Educational attainment rate, completed lower secondary education or in Portugal
Portugal: Educational attainment rate, completed lower secondary education or was 67.0% in 2023. ▲ Rising
Educational attainment rate, completed lower secondary education or in Portugal, 1998–2023
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ics. Measured in %.
Analysis
Portugal recorded 67.0% for educational attainment rate, completed lower secondary education or in 2023. That is the highest value across all 26 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 1.6% on the previous year and up 18.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, educational attainment rate, completed lower secondary education or in Portugal peaked at 67.0% in 2023 and was at its lowest, 30.0%, in 1998.
Portugal ranks 63rd of 97 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 26 years of available data.
Educational attainment rate, completed lower secondary education or in Portugal, year by year
| Year | % |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 1998 | 30.0% | — |
| 1999 | 31.4% | +4.4% |
| 2000 | 33.0% | +5.1% |
| 2001 | 34.4% | +4.4% |
| 2002 | 34.7% | +0.9% |
| 2003 | 37.7% | +8.7% |
| 2004 | 41.2% | +9.1% |
| 2005 | 42.8% | +3.9% |
| 2006 | 44.3% | +3.4% |
| 2007 | 45.1% | +1.9% |
| 2008 | 46.2% | +2.4% |
| 2009 | 47.4% | +2.7% |
| 2010 | 48.8% | +2.9% |
| 2011 | 51.9% | +6.4% |
| 2012 | 55.1% | +6.1% |
| 2013 | 56.5% | +2.5% |
| 2014 | 58.3% | +3.2% |
| 2015 | 59.3% | +1.8% |
| 2016 | 58.7% | -1.1% |
| 2017 | 57.0% | -2.9% |
| 2018 | 55.7% | -2.2% |
| 2019 | 59.7% | +7.1% |
| 2020 | 62.0% | +4.0% |
| 2021 | 64.2% | +3.5% |
| 2022 | 65.9% | +2.6% |
| 2023 | 67.0% | +1.6% |
